The Edward T. LeBlanc Memorial Dime Novel Bibliography

Series - Captain Heron Series of Highwayman Tales

Language:English
Publisher: Dick & Fitzgerald (New York (N.Y.): 18 Ann St.) -- United States
Category: Format : Larger Booklet
Issues: 7 (Highest number seen advertised)
Dates: 1863 (No. 4 shows copyright date of 1863)
Schedule: Not known
Price: 25ยข
Size: 9 5/8 x 6"
Pages: 100 to 112
Illustrations: Colored cover with 4 inside black and white illustrations.
Notes / Commentary:

The title of series appears at top. No ads have been found bearing this title. Ads show series as Celebrated Highwaymen and Housebreakers without numbers. It is unclear from LeBlanc's notes whether the same stories were issued under two separate series titles, or if these are two names for the same set of books.

The same author wrote the full series of seven books. No. 4 shows author of all other stories.

Items

1. Captain Heron; or, The Highwayman of Epping Forest
2. Jonathan Wild's Stratagem; or, The Highwayman's Escape
3. The Hangman of Newgate; or, The Highwayman's Adventure
4. Claude Duval and His Companions; or, The Race on the Road
5. Tom Ripon; or, The Highwayman and Housebreaker
6. The Highwayman's Ride to York; or, The Death of Black Bess
7. Blueskin Baffled; or, The Highwayman's Trap
